Elena Adelina Panaet (born 5 June 1993)[1][2] is a Romanian long-distance and steeplechase runner. In 2020, she competed in the women's half marathon at the 2020 World Athletics Half Marathon Championships held in Gdynia, Poland.[2]

She was suspended for doping for four years from 20 February 2016 to 19 February 2020.[3][4][5]
